Roll-on and roll-off (Ro-Ro) ship is the most economical transporting method for large freights such as train, helicopter, and aircraft body. To ship a large freight to a designated location on deck of Ro-Ro ship, tractor is used to pull a trailer with a connecting link of goose neck shape, on which the freight is secured. When the freight is long enough, the trajectory of trailer is not same as that of trailer and is a three dimensional path, which can cause any collision with ramp, gate, and obstacles in the deck. This research proposes a method of calculating possible trajectories to drive a tractor, along which does not cause any collision. Assuming reasonably low speed of a tractor, the proposed method generates possible tractor paths based on Bezier curve to calculate the trailer path considering tilt of tractor and trailer when they go up the inclined ramp. Finally, it calculates the best three paths without any collision in order of priority with minimum shipping time. The proposed method can be useful for the transport company to determine the shipping possibility as well as to generate driving order for a tractor driver.
